Abstract
Young children are exposed to various hazards both within and outside their home environments. Studies evaluating the causes of a high prevalence of injuries to young children have found childhood impulsiveness and curiosity, lack of general awareness, dependence on caregivers for safety, and lack of adequate supervision by adult caregivers among the reasons.
